Each website in the world is identified by a unique number (IP address), just like international phone numbers, for example 151.101.129.121.
As these numbers are hard to remember, unique words and phrases are used to permanently link to these numbers. So instead of typing the long number above, it's much easier to remember and type lifewire.com, which will redirect your browser to the the IP address above, where the actual website is hosted. The domain extensions show the country of registration of that domain. For example .eu is European Union, .me is Montenegro etc.
Web hosting is a service that allows organizations and individuals to post a website or web page onto the Internet. A web host, or web hosting service provider, is a business that provides the technologies and services needed for the website or webpage to be viewed in the Internet. Websites are hosted, or stored, on special computers called servers. When Internet users want to view your website, all they need to do is type your website address or domain into their browser. Their computer will then connect to your server and your web pages will be delivered to them through the browser. (Cited from website.com)
